Abstract

Clinical outcomes in South African rural clinics have been a subject of interest due to their unique challenges and resource constraints. A Bayesian hierarchical model was developed to analyse data from multiple rural clinics in South Africa. The model incorporates both fixed effects (clinic-specific factors) and random effects (clinic variation). The analysis revealed significant clinic variations in clinical outcomes, with some clinics outperforming others by over 20%. The Bayesian hierarchical model provided a nuanced understanding of clinic performance, highlighting the importance of contextual factors and variability. Further research should focus on implementing targeted interventions to improve underperforming clinics based on identified patterns.
